The realme 15T 5G was officially launched in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, on October 30, 2025, featuring an ‘rPhone’ aesthetic inspired by local culture.
The device boasts a 120Hz-ready 4000nit 4R Comfort+ AMOLED Display for vibrant and smooth visuals.
Under the hood, it’s pow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 6400 Max 5G chipset and offers substantial multitasking capability with up to 12GB of dynamic RAM.
Design-wise, it maintains a sleek profile, measuring only 7.79mm thick and is available in Flowing Silver and Suit Titanium colors.
A major highlight of the realme 15T is its endurance and rapid charging capabilities.
It is equipped with a massive 7000mAh battery, designed to keep users connected for extended periods.
When a recharge is needed, the device supports 60W SUPERVOOC charging, which can achieve a full charge in less than an hour.
Photography is handled by a 50MP AI dual-camera setup utilizing MagicGlow technology.
Furthermore, the phone introduces the AI Edit Genie software feature, an innovative, voice-controlled tool for image editing.
Price and Malaysia availability
The pricing structure for the realme 15T 5G is based on two main configurations.
The base model, featuring 8GB RAM and 256GB storage, has a Recommended Retail Price (RRP) of RM1,199.
The higher-tier variant, which boosts the dynamic RAM to 12GB while retaining 256GB storage, is priced at RM1,299. These competitive price points aim to make 5G technology accessible to a broad Malaysian audience.
In terms of availability, the realme 15T 5G is widely distributed across both physical and digital channels.
Customers can purchase the smartphone at all realme Brand Stores and authorised dealer stores.
Online shoppers can find it on official platforms including Shopee, Lazada, and TikTok Shop. The 12GB model is also offered through major telco partners: Maxis, U Mobile, and redOne.
